regexp和src都是字串,并且count是指向用于滾動字串的計數器的指標。它應該得到盡快']'在發現regexp的,但它似乎并不奏效。
int inParent(char *src, char *regexp, int *count) {
int check = 0;
printf("%d", *count);
for (*count = 0; *(regexp *count) != ']'; *count 1) {
if (*(regexp *count) == *src)
check = 1;
}
if (check == 1)
return 1;
return 0;
}
uj5u.com熱心網友回復:
您的計數沒有增加。
int inParent(char *src, char *regexp, int *count) {
int check = 0;
printf("%d", *count);
for (*count = 0; *(regexp (*count)) != '\0'; *count = 1) {
if (*(regexp (*count)) == *src)
check = 1;
}
if (check == 1)
return 1;
return 0;
}
轉載請註明出處,本文鏈接:https://www.uj5u.com/caozuo/356273.html
上一篇:指向多型物件的指標的初始化
下一篇:為什么不能用指標改變字符?
